## Build Provenance: Ormwright Refactor

Welcome aboard! If you're touching the old Ormwright ORM layer, know that every refactor branch gets a signed provenance record before merge. This keeps us honest about which query-builder rewrites actually shipped to the Tindale cluster. Don't hand-edit generated mappers — regenerate and let CI stamp them. The current canonical refactor snapshot corresponds to the following build.

build token for kagaf-hahof: htk14_9d3d4d26d7d8de

Quick context for the eng sync: the Pellmill queue now runs log compaction on the `orders` and `inventory` topics. Compaction keeps only the latest record per key, so consumers that replay history must switch to the snapshot feed. Retention before compaction is 48 hours; the compactor runs on the Dovebridge cluster every 20 minutes. To run the compactor locally, create a `.env` with `PELLMILL_COMPACT_INTERVAL=1200` and `PELLMILL_TOPIC_FILTER=orders,inventory`. Below those, the compactor needs its broker credential:

vault entry, yahif-yajep: COURIER_KEY29=b802bdf8034096b65a51c6ba5abe2

/*
 * Nightly reindex client — Harborglass Search.
 * Context for the weekly sync: this job rebuilds the full product
 * index between 02:00 and 04:00 local time, reading from the
 * Tidemark replica so the primary stays untouched. It checkpoints
 * every 10k documents, so a failed run can resume rather than
 * restart. Please review the batch-size tuning in config.yaml before
 * changing anything. The client authenticates to the indexing
 * service with the key below.
 */

API key for kafop-fafof: qvz3-4pw

Visiting contractors at Fennwick House may use the quiet room on the top floor for calls and focused work, provided they are escorted past the Larkspur atrium by their sponsor. Food is not permitted, and the room must be left as found. The door remains locked at all times; contractors should enter using the pass code below.

staff pass of kagup-fajog = bdg-QCHVQW-99665837